What does NUETRAL mean? Does it mean NATURAL? For instance A NUETRAL ACCENT.

It is spelt neutral. And it depends on what you are talking about. It could mean 1) not supporting either side (of an argument, war etc). 2) It could mean indistinct or vague. 3) It could be the gear of a motor vehicle. 4) It could mean, in terms of colour, not strong, like the colour grey. 5) In chemistry it is neither acid nor alkali. 6) It is not positive or negative. Neutral means unbiased, neither supporting one side nor opposing the other. A neutral accent means an accent without an obvious bias towards a particular way of speaking (British, Australian accent, etc...). P.S 'Neutral' is the right spelling. 😄👍 I hope that helped!
